Description Clean Harborsis looking forSolids Control Techto join their safety conscious team inRed Deer, AB. This position isresponsible for the maintenance and repair of all the oilfield rental equipment. Provide customers with exceptional service while operating equipment. Troubleshooting and repair of minor electrical issues, assisting with the rigging up and rigging out of solids control equipment and completing all required paperwork. Why work for Clean Harbors? Health and Safety is our #1 priority and we live it 3-6-5 Competitive wages Comprehensive health benefits coverage after 30 days of full-time employment Group RRSP with company matching component Generous paid time off, company paid training and tuition reimbursement Positive and safe work environments Opportunities for growth and development for all the stages of your career Responsibilities Ensuring that Health and Safety is the number one priority by complying with all safe work practices, policies, and processes and acting in a safe manner at all times; Rigging in and Rig out, repair and maintain Solids Control Equipment Sit in on client location on a rotating day or night shift as scheduled to ensure equipment runs efficiently Troubleshoot and repair minor electrical issues as well as any other issues that arise Complete all required paper work daily (safety documents, JSA''s, work orders, service records and daily reports) Work in shop during slow periods to assist in the maintenance and repair of all Clean Harbors equipment Service and maintain solids control equipment on a weekly basis Perform all required maintenance and repairs to various types of rental equipment Perform maintenance which follows the manufacturer guidelines for service times and inspections by requesting additional information, as required, from the establishment in which the equipment was purchased Ensure all equipment in need for repair has been approved for repair by the Shop Superintendent or Branch Management Notify management when repaired equipment is ready for use Qualifications Valid Class 5 Driver''s License required; Must have experience maintaining, and Rig in/out Solids Control Equipment Centrifuges, Pumps First-Aid and H2S Alive safety tickets arerequired upon hire; Strong mechanical and troubleshooting skills; Superior communication skills, attention to detail, organizational and analytical skills Ability to oversee, coach and mentor apprentices and other shop laborers 40-years of sustainability in action.Clean Harborsis the leading provider of environmental, energy and industrial services throughout the United States, Canada, Mexico and Puerto Rico.
